  6. Just a bit of a fun and perhaps motivational story. In 2017, I was going through an incredibly difficult divorce from a man I had only been married to for two years. Turned out that he had some very mean and troublesome issues. I found myself in a very broken state; sad, defeated, embarrassed. So, what did I do? I set my mind to save for a school bus, that I would convert into my home. While in the "saving the cash" phase, I bought a toy school bus that sat on my desk, for a constant reminder as to why I was working so hard. I bought that bus. I converted that bus. I lived in that bus for 3.5 years. I am back in a house for now. That bus? That bus will be sold soon and will be the down payment for my new dream; an Oliver! 🙂 So, I had to buy a new toy. It's definitely not an exact replica, but it is working just fine! Tentative plan is to buy the truck in April and pull the trigger on my Ollie order between June and September. I learned in my school bus journey that best laid plans don't always work out but dreams DO come true when you just don't give up!

  12. Well, this TV shopping might be a bit more difficult than I thought. Ford dealership only had 1 red (not one of my color choices) 2500 and said they are having a hard time finding them. Almost an $80,000 price tag. The Chevy dealership had 1 2500 Dodge that I just didn't care for and NO 2500 Chevy. So, I went home and got on CarMax and found a few Chevy and Dodge possibilities, with no Ford options. Mileage from 10-45k with price tags from $40-55,000.00. With the price of trucks right now, might end up with new to me instead of brand new. I did test drive the one 2500 Ford and was happy to see that I enjoyed driving it and will have no problem using it as my daily driver to work also. My work is just down the street.
